The strategies get a bit more complex when you factor momentum into the portals. If you place two portals on the ground next to each other, and dive into one from a high platform, you will then pop out of the other into the air with a momentum boost, which adds a bit of a platforming challenge to the puzzles. Where Portal starts to take a drastic turn from the traditional puzzle game structure is also where the most questions arise. For instance: Portal has a story that takes place within the Half-Life 2 universe, with an entirely new female main character, and features progression over the course of the game. So you'll start the game with nothing in your hands, earn your way up to a "gun" that shoots one portal at a time, then a version of that gun which shoots two portals at a time so you can connect them, then presumably later on an upgraded version that simulates the gravity gun power from Half-Life 2 (as was seen in the initial trailer).
